首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何使用编译后的Typescript文件。(Ts),它是另一个项目中的(.js)

编译后的Typescript文件(.ts)是一种使用TypeScript编程语言编写的源代码文件。TypeScript是一种由Microsoft开发的开源编程语言,它是JavaScript的超集,添加了静态类型和其他一些功能,以提高代码的可维护性和可读性。

要使用编译后的Typescript文件,可以按照以下步骤进行操作:

  1. 安装Node.js和TypeScript:首先,确保在计算机上安装了Node.js运行时环境和TypeScript编译器。可以在Node.js官方网站(https://nodejs.org)上下载并安装Node.js,然后使用以下命令全局安装TypeScript:npm install -g typescript
  2. 创建Typescript文件:使用任何文本编辑器创建一个以.ts为扩展名的文件,并编写TypeScript代码。例如,创建一个名为app.ts的文件,并添加以下示例代码:
  3. 创建Typescript文件:使用任何文本编辑器创建一个以.ts为扩展名的文件,并编写TypeScript代码。例如,创建一个名为app.ts的文件,并添加以下示例代码:
  4. 编译Typescript文件:在命令行中,导航到包含Typescript文件的目录,并运行以下命令将.ts文件编译为可执行的JavaScript文件:
  5. 编译Typescript文件:在命令行中,导航到包含Typescript文件的目录,并运行以下命令将.ts文件编译为可执行的JavaScript文件:
  6. 上述命令将使用TypeScript编译器将app.ts文件编译为app.js文件。
  7. 在其他项目中使用编译后的JavaScript文件:编译后的JavaScript文件(.js)可以像任何其他JavaScript文件一样在项目中使用。将app.js文件复制到您希望使用它的项目目录中,并在项目中的其他文件中引用它即可。例如,在另一个JavaScript文件中使用app.js的代码:
  8. 在其他项目中使用编译后的JavaScript文件:编译后的JavaScript文件(.js)可以像任何其他JavaScript文件一样在项目中使用。将app.js文件复制到您希望使用它的项目目录中,并在项目中的其他文件中引用它即可。例如,在另一个JavaScript文件中使用app.js的代码:
  9. 注意,编译后的JavaScript文件可以与其他JavaScript文件一起构建、打包和部署,以便在服务器端或客户端应用程序中使用。

综上所述,使用编译后的Typescript文件的步骤包括安装Node.js和TypeScript,创建Typescript文件,使用TypeScript编译器将.ts文件编译为.js文件,然后在其他项目中使用编译后的JavaScript文件。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

了不起 tsconfig.json 指南

[封面.png] 在 TypeScript 开发中,tsconfig.json 是个不可或缺配置文件它是我们在 TS目中最常见配置文件,那么你真的了解这个文件吗?它里面都有哪些优秀配置?...执行编译 配置完成,我们可以在命令行执行 tsc 命令,执行编译完成,我们可以得到一个 index.js 文件和一个 index.js.map 文件,证明我们编译成功,其中 index.js 文件内容如下...使用 --noImplicitThis 配置:  在 TS2.0 还增加一个新编译选项: --noImplicitThis,表示当 this 表达式值为 any 类型时生成一个错误信息。...文中通过一个简单 learnTsconfig 项目,让大家知道项目中如何使用 tsconfig.json 文件。在后续文章中,我们将这么多配置进行分类学习。...《TypeScript编译配置文件JSON模式》 4.《详解TypeScript目中tsconfig.json配置》  5.

2.6K42
  • TS】612- 了不起 tsconfig.json 指南

    TypeScript 开发中,tsconfig.json 是个不可或缺配置文件它是我们在 TS目中最常见配置文件,那么你真的了解这个文件吗?它里面都有哪些优秀配置?...为什么使用 tsconfig.json 通常我们可以使用 tsc 命令来编译少量 TypeScript 文件: /* 参数介绍: --outFile // 编译后生成文件名称 --target...执行编译 配置完成,我们可以在命令行执行 tsc 命令,执行编译完成,我们可以得到一个 index.js 文件和一个 index.js.map 文件,证明我们编译成功,其中 index.js 文件内容如下...使用 --noImplicitThis 配置: 在 TS2.0 还增加一个新编译选项: --noImplicitThis,表示当 this 表达式值为 any 类型时生成一个错误信息。...文中通过一个简单 learnTsconfig 项目,让大家知道项目中如何使用 tsconfig.json 文件。在后续文章中,我们将这么多配置进行分类学习。

    2K30

    了不起 tsconfig.json 指南

    TypeScript 开发中,tsconfig.json 是个不可或缺配置文件它是我们在 TS目中最常见配置文件,那么你真的了解这个文件吗?它里面都有哪些优秀配置?...为什么使用 tsconfig.json 通常我们可以使用 tsc 命令来编译少量 TypeScript 文件: /* 参数介绍: --outFile // 编译后生成文件名称 --target...执行编译 配置完成,我们可以在命令行执行 tsc 命令,执行编译完成,我们可以得到一个 index.js 文件和一个 index.js.map 文件,证明我们编译成功,其中 index.js 文件内容如下...使用 --noImplicitThis 配置: 在 TS2.0 还增加一个新编译选项: --noImplicitThis,表示当 this 表达式值为 any 类型时生成一个错误信息。...文中通过一个简单 learnTsconfig 项目,让大家知道项目中如何使用 tsconfig.json 文件。在后续文章中,我们将这么多配置进行分类学习。

    2.9K10

    从0到1开启一个全新TypeScript项目

    然后是一个 interface 继承另一个类型不做任何扩展,这样写法相当于这两个类型就是完全相等,也不应该出现这样写法。...true,因为在我们项目中 tsc 只负责进行类型检查,并不真实输出 js 和.d.ts 文件。...这里有一个点值得说一下,关于.d.ts 和.ts 区别: .d.ts 和.ts 区别 .d.ts编译器从你.ts 代码中分离出来js 部分,类似于接口定义规范。...从上图中可以看出.d.ts 是给 js 文件提供类型声明,通常来说它是 tsc 自动生成。...由于这些文件本身无法定义类型,最直接想法是加上 @ts-except-error,这确实可以解决问题,但是需要注意,如果使用ts-expect-error,加下来代码中没有真实类型错误,编译器会提示

    60410

    如何在 Windows 上安装 Angular:Angular CLI、Node.js 和构建工具指南

    安装 Angular CLI ,您需要运行一个命令来生成一个项目,并运行另一个命令来使用本地开发服务器来运行您应用程序。...run: 运行项目中定义自定义目标。 serve (s): 构建并服务您应用程序,根据文件更改进行重建。 test (t): 在项目中运行单元测试。 update: 更新您应用程序及其依赖。...它还会询问您要使用样式表格式(例如 CSS)。选择您选项并按 Enter 键继续。 之后,您将使用目录结构和一堆配置和代码文件创建项目。它将主要采用 TypeScript 和 JSON 格式。...需要 CSS 支持 favicon.ico:网站图标 index.html:主要 HTML 文件 karma.conf.js:Karma(测试工具)配置文件 main.ts:AppModule 引导主启动文件...polyfills.ts:Angular 所需 polyfill styles.css:项目的全局样式表文件 test.ts:这是 Karma 配置文件 tsconfig.*.json:TypeScript

    36300

    「译」面向 JavaScript 开发人员 TSConfig 简介

    TypeScript 是一个通过添加类型来提高代码质量和维护效率重大创新,因此毫不奇怪它是目前增长最快语言之一。如果你从未使用编译语言或编译器,TypeScript 可能会让你感到害怕。...或者也许你遇到过复杂 tsconfig.json 文件,而你并不完全理解。这篇博文是介绍 TypeScript (TS) 以及如何配置你项目以轻松使用 TypeScript。️...从 JS 到 TSTypeScript 构建在 JavaScript 之上。它是一个超集——任何有效 JavaScript 是有效 TypeScript。...大多数现代项目将使用 ES6 或 ESNext。outDir - 指定编译 JavaScript 文件输出目录。通常设置为 dist 为编译文件创建 dist 目录。...使用 tsconfig.json 文件作为解锁项目中 TypeScript 全部潜力切入口。

    9910

    Flow 与 Typescript:哪个更适合你项目?

    它是开源,并得到了一个庞大而活跃社区支持 TypeScript 是 JavaScript 类型化超集,可编译为纯 JavaScript。...编译器接收 TypeScript 文件(.ts 或 .tsx),然后将它们“转换”为可由浏览器运行有效 JavaScript 代码。...使用 Flow,您不必更改文件扩展名,而是继续在带注释文件.js和.jsx文件中编写普通 JavaScript 如果我们保留上面的代码,JavaScript 引擎会因为注释而抛出错误; 因此,作为额外步骤...yarn add typescript @types/node @types/react @types/react-dom @types/jest 接下来,我们将现有的.js和.jsx文件重命名为.ts...每次要使用 Flow 检查文件时,我们都必须运行相同命令。对于使用 VS Code 用户,可以使用Flow Language Support在每次保存自动执行 Flow 检查。

    2K30

    TypeScript 入门指南:从 JavaScript 到强类型开发世界

    安装完成,你可以使用 tsc 命令来编译 TypeScript 文件。 同事: 好,我已经安装好了。那么,有什么示例可以让我更好地理解 TypeScript 语法吗? 了不起: 当然!...它提供了强大工具和功能,用于构建现代化 Web 应用程序。 Vue.js:Vue.js另一个流行前端框架,它也可以使用 TypeScript 进行开发。...第三方库类型定义:当使用第三方 JavaScript 库时,它们可能没有提供 TypeScript 类型定义文件(.d.ts)。...类型声明文件以 .d.ts 后缀结尾,它告诉 TypeScript 如何与该库进行交互。 编译配置:TypeScript 提供了丰富编译选项,你可以根据项目的需求进行配置。...TypeScript 允许你在项目中使用 .js 和 .ts 文件共存,并且通过逐步添加类型注解,逐步将 JavaScript 代码转换为 TypeScript

    24120

    深入理解 TypeScript 模块

    TypeScript模块如何查找,为什么会隐式查找到index.ts、index.js,为什么会到 node_modules 中去找模块? 如何定义一个全局变量供所有代码共享?...解析算法可以在Node.js module documentation找到 ▐ 9.3 Node.js 如何解析模块 为了理解 TypeScript 编译依照解析步骤,先弄明白 Node.js 模块是非常重要...有何区别 当使用 Node 模块解析策略是,TypeScript 是模仿 Node.js 运行时解析策略来在编译阶段定位模块定义文件。...通常 tsconfig.json 文件主要包含两部分内容:指定待编译文件和定义编译选项。 tsconfig.json 配置可以用一张图来简单进行说明: ?...涉及到下面两个配置: baseUrl:解析非相对模块根地址,默认是当前目录 paths:路径映射别名,相对于baseUrl 比如我们项目中基础模块,由于和业务模块是独立,如果使用相对路径进行引用

    2.5K30

    TypeScript 工程化实践方案

    一.TypeScript编译选项和tsconfig.json配置选项 二.使用webpack打包ts代码 上一篇系统地总结学习了TypeScript基础常用语法。...一.TypeScript编译选项和tsconfig.json配置选项 JavaScript代码可以直接被浏览器执行,而TypeScript则需要编译才能被执行,比如使用tsc命令编译。...但这就会显得很麻烦,每次都要运行命令,编译才能被执行。而且项目里不止写一个TypeScript文件,如果有多个ts文件,我们一个一个去编译那也太麻烦了。...设置为 true 时,js 文件会被 tsc 编译,否则不会。一般在项目中 js, ts 混合开发时需要设置。..."noEmitOnError": true, /*当有错误时不生成编译文件,默认为false*/ "alwaysStrict": true, /*是否为编译js开启严格模式,默认为

    84930

    TypeScript在前端项目的渐进式采用策略

    渐进式采用 TypeScript 在前端项目中策略通常包括:引入TypeScript如果我们有一个简单JavaScript模块utils.js,它包含一个函数用于计算两数之和:// utils.jsexport...ECMAScript版本 "target": "es6", // 指定模块系统 "module": "esnext", // 输出目录,编译文件存放位置 "outDir": "....": true, // 包含哪些文件进行编译 "include": [ "src/**/*.ts", "src/**/*.tsx" // 如果项目中使用TypeScriptJSX...], // 排除哪些文件或目录不进行编译 "exclude": [ "node_modules", "**/*.spec.ts" // 排除测试文件 ]}高级配置paths:...自动类型推断安装完类型定义TypeScript编译器会自动识别并使用这些类型定义。你无需在代码中显式引入它们,只要在项目中正常引用库即可。3.

    9610

    「React TS3 专题」从创建第一个 React TypeScript3 项目开始

    entry:设置 webpack 从哪里开始寻找要捆绑模块,在我们目中入口文件是 index.tsx module:设置 webpack 如何处理不同模块,webpack 使用 ts-loader...处理 ts 文件和 tsx 扩展 resolve:设置 webpack 如何解析模块 output:设置 webpack 把代码编译到哪里去,输出到哪个文件夹。...这里输出目录是 dist,编译文件名是 bundle.js devServer:设置 webpack 开发服务器,根目录是 dist 文件夹,并通过端口9000进行访问 10、最终项目文件夹 如果你顺利到了这一步...,多出来了一个 bundle.js 文件: npm run build bundle.js 会将用到依赖和我们 react 组件代码都编译压缩成一个文件。...今天内容就到这里,我们学习了如何使用 create-react-app 和 手工两种方式创建 React TypeScript3目。

    2.2K10

    tsconfig.json 配置文件详解 | 02

    # tsconfig.json (Ts 配置文件) tsconfig.json 是 ts目中配置文件。.../src/**/*"] } tsconfig.json 文件中有很多属性,这样简单说下上面四个属性含义 outDir 指定编译文件存放目录 allowJs 指定源目录 JavaScript 文件是否原样拷贝到编译目录...target 指定编译产物 js 版本 include 指定那些文件需要编译 tsconfig.json 文件可以不必手写,使用 tsc 命令 --init 参数自动生成 tsc --init #...如果两者有重名属性,后者会覆盖前者。 # 4、files files 属性指定编译文件列表,如果其中一个文件不存在,就会报错。 它是一个数组,排在前面的文件编译。.../ 使用上面脚手架创建,项目中自动生成tsconfig.json 文件 正确配置打包 dist 命令 先创建 config 配置目录,输入以下命令 npm eject 打开 config 目录,config

    1.2K10

    一些你需要掌握 tsconfig.json 常用配置

    我们经常用它来排除编译输出目录、测试文件目录、一些生成文件脚本等文件。默认值为 "node_modules,bower_componen"; extends:继承另一个 ts 配置文件。...项目中如果有多个相互独立模块,可以使用这个属性来做分离。这样一个模块改变,就只重新编译这个模块,其他模块不重新编译编译时要改用 tsc --build。这在非常大目中应该能有不小收益。...TS 编译变成 JS 是不携带类型信息。如果你想要保留信息,就需要一个 d.ts 文件来描述对应 JS 文件。...outFile 将所有 ts 文件合并编译生成一个 js 文件和它类型声明 d.ts 文件。 这个配置很少用,因为它只能用在不支持模块化导入系统,即所有的 ts 文件都是全局。...换句话说,module 配置需要为 None、System 或 AMD。 "outFile": "./app.js" module 编译 JS 使用哪种模块系统。

    1.5K10

    初次在Vue项目使用TypeScript,需要做什么

    ,提供了类型定义文件(*.d.ts),开发者编写类型定义文件发布到npm上,当使用者需要在 TypeScript目中使用该库时,可以另外下载这个包,让JS库能够在 TypeScript目中运行。...如果我们想要在 TypeScript目中使用,还需要另外下载 @tyeps/md5,在该文件index.d.ts中可以看到为 md5 定义类型。...是如何识别 *.d.ts TypeScript 在项目编译时会全局自动识别 *.d.ts文件,我们需要做就是编写 *.d.ts,然后 TypeScript 会将这些编写类型定义注入到全局提供使用。...当一些类型或接口等需要频繁使用时,我们可以为项目编写全局类型定义, 根路径下创建@types文件夹,里面存放*.d.ts文件,专门用于管理项目中类型定义文件。...在导入ts文件时,不需要加 .ts 后缀 为项目定义全局变量无法正常使用,重新跑一遍服务器(我就碰到过...)

    6.5K40
    领券